Somehow after Mesopotamian and Greek sewers, humanity mostly abandoned any complex version. Wasn't until the late 1800's and early 1900's we dove back into sewer development with any remotely significant engineering improvements. For thousands of years sewers remained mostly unimproved in city design or functionality then out of desperation from people dying in the street and unbearable odors they slapdashed something together. It's probably not a terrible idea to take another look at how we do it. | ||

Most of our early sewers were basically just shit/runoff streams that were dumped into rivers and lakes. The whole water treatment part came after most US cities already had their main centers. Sewage treatment (beyond harvesting fertilizer) has been an after thought right up until the mid 1900's and the EPA | ||

Anyways all this to say that I am pretty sure it would be pretty inefficient in a large city environment. https://www.orenco.com/products/treatment-systems is the type that I am familiar with and I am pretty sure you can find some numbers in there for filtration footprint per bedroom/occupant (i can tell you one "pod" handles 500 gallons per day off the top of my head) etc if you really care and then compare with some of the larger operations but obviously it doesnt really answer your question. btw there is no question at all that there is far superior waste treatment technology than currently in use in most places in the US. like with anything updating to current technology is expensive. | ||
